Output 677e55ee6ba4bae81a76c99f0e2a7bda71b620068f59eb9e97a7ec2e31dd78f1:0

value
10836666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fc74c20160ced6a931bd05fd8ec7490bd17bdb6 OP_EQUAL
address
37WFF41cjv4DXoVxJsvb6LXN7p6daCqJWZ
transaction
677e55ee6ba4bae81a76c99f0e2a7bda71b620068f59eb9e97a7ec2e31dd78f1
spent
true